1994 Toyota RAV4 Recalls
No NHTSA recalls on record for the 1994 Toyota RAV4. That means NHTSA has no open safety campaign for this vehicle — it does not guarantee the absence of problems. Owners have filed 4 complaints with NHTSA, most often about the air bags. Last updated July 5, 2026.
